Intuitive Adaptability and Versatile Placement Options
A key draw of the Classic is… Special Editions is their adaptability to various environments and user needs. With a slightly smaller stature, measuring just under 4-feet tall, they are perfect for personal spaces, family rooms, or even children’s game zones. However, the manufacturer also provides an option to elevate the cabinet’s height with an official Arcade1Up Riser, priced at $59. This accessory adds roughly 14.25 inches, transforming the unit to match the stature of Deluxe editions that stand five feet tall. Such versatility ensures that whether intended for casual family entertainment or adult gaming nostalgia, the products can be adjusted to provide comfortable, ergonomic gameplay. This option further accentuates their flexibility in modern living spaces.
Exploring the Rich Game Libraries
Every cabinet in this assortment is equipped with a curated set of games that pay tribute to gaming classics. The Ms. Pac-Man cabinet includes a total of 13 titles, where five titles pay specific homage to the Pac universe. Games like Pac-Mania, Pac-Man Plus, and Super Pac-Man provide layers of gameplay variety. Similarly, the Pac-Man cabinet offers an engaging roster of 13 games, with titles carefully swapped to present variety including King & Balloon replacing Tower of Druaga. Beyond these, the Mortal Kombat-themed machine serves as a battleground for those born in the fighting game era, featuring a selection that ranges from classic tournament hits to engaging non-fighting titles. Each game is selected to combine nostalgia with timeless gameplay mechanics, making these cabinets enduring sources of entertainment.

Compact Modules for the Modern Arcade Enthusiast
Beyond the standing cabinets, the lineup includes countercade solutions designed for limited spaces and portable enjoyment. These countercades come in two distinct themes, one featuring a blend of Ms. Pac-Man and Galaga, and the other focused solely on Pac-Man. Each countercade comes with a vertically oriented 7-inch LCD display that is tailored for quick play sessions, making them an excellent addition to any countertop or small room. They are designed to operate via Micro-USB or powered operated with AA batteries (not supplied in the package) the package), emphasizing portability and ease of use. With a selection of three preloaded games on each, these models offer a concise yet evocative arcade experience that can be enjoyed in both home and office environments, reflecting both convenience and enduring appeal.
